首页 > 建站学院 > jsp技术 > 如何查看空间是否开启了gd库,如何在PHP测试环境中开启gd库

如何查看空间是否开启了gd库,如何在PHP测试环境中开启gd库

来源:整理 时间:2023-06-06 02:27:05 编辑:建站知识 手机版

1,如何在PHP测试环境中开启gd库

php里有的phpinfo函数啊也就是一句话的事,web的所有信息都显示出来了。

如何在PHP测试环境中开启gd库

2,如何查看系统是否安装了gd库

GD库是干什么用的呢!它是php处理图形的扩展库,GD库提供了一系列用来处理图片的API,使用GD库可以处理图片,或者生成图片。GD库在php中默认是没有开启的,如果想让它支持图片处理功能,那么就要手动开启GD库  工具/原料  wampserer(我一直用这个集成环境)  win7  方法/步骤  找到php.ini文件,有两种方法:  方法一:wampserver安装目录下找到路径wamp\bin\mysql\mysql5.5.24\php.ini(我安装的根目录是D盘)  方法二:启动wampserver,单击任务栏wamp图标,选中PHP,看到php.ini,点击进入php.ini文件  打开php.ini文件  用查找工具找到extension=php_gd2.dll,把extension=php_gd2.dll 前面的【;】,介样子就可以了  测试能否用GD库
方法1 :将下面的程序保存为一个后缀为 .php 的文件 把这个文件存为 phpinfo.php,然后传到服务器的网站目录下,在浏览器访问这个文件,如: xxx.xxx.xxx/bbs/phpinfo.php然后搜索这个页面里面是否存在 gd 库,如果搜不到,说明没有装 gd 库。如果存在并且开启了则如下图所示:方法2:利用function_exists函数;如果返回值为1,刚说明服务器支持gd库。在linux控制台查询配置状态:php -i|grep -i --color gd如果没有gd support => enabled则表明未配置成功。

如何查看系统是否安装了gd库

3,如何查看php是否支持GD库

windows下开启php的gd库支持找到php.ini,打开内容,找到:;extension=php_gd2.dll把最前面的分号“;”去掉,再保存即可,如果本来就没有分号,那就是已经开启了。linux下开启php的gd库支持#开启gd库支持有以下几种方法##检测gd库是否安装命令 php5 -m | grep -i gd 或者 php -i | grep -i --color gd##如未安装gd库,则为服务器安装,方法如下### 如果是源码安装,则加入参数 --with-gd### 如果是debian系的linux系统,用apt-get安装,如下 apt-get install php5-gd### 如果是centos系的系统,用yum安装,如下 yum install php-gd### 如果是suse系的linux系统,用yast安装,如下 yast -i php5_gd### 如果嫌这个世界不够蛋疼呢,可以在原先编译php不支持gd的情况下附加 先下zlib源码,libpng源码,gd源码 解压后到源码目录 zlib目录 ./configure --prefix=/usr/local/zlib make ; make install make clean libpng目录 cp scripts/makefile.linux ./makefile ./configure --prefix=/usr/local/libpng make ; make install make clean gd目录 ./configure --prefix=/usr/local/libgd --with-png=/usr/local/libpng make ; make install make clean 最后在php.ini中,搜到[gd]后,在下面加一行 extension=/usr/local/libgdgd.so 然后重启php服务,如果不行,试试reboot 好了,不过最后提醒一下,要知道这个世界很多意外的,源码安装,只添加gd库这一个情况下,php版本和库的版本各异,所以: - 不保证这么付出了这么多后有回报 - 不保证能够成功加载gd.so - 不保证不怀孕 所以如果是源码安装,最好还是在编译php的时候加参数--with-gdgd库函数getimagesize作用:取得图片的大小[即长与宽] 用法:array getimagesize(string filename, array [imageinfo]); imagearc作用:画弧线 用法:int imagearc(int im, int cx, int cy, int w, int h, int s, int e, int col); imagechar作用:写出横向字符 用法:int imagechar(int im, int font, int x, int y, string c, int col); imagecharup作用:写出竖式字符 用法:int imagecharup(int im, int font, int x, int y, string c, int col);imagecolorallocate作用:匹配颜色 用法:int imagecolorallocate(int im, int red, int green, int blue); imagecolortransparent作用:指定透明背景色 用法:int imagecolortransparent(int im, int [col]);imagecopyresized作用:复制新图并调整大小 用法:int imagecopyresized(int dst_im, int src_im, int dstx, int dsty, int srcx,int srcy, int dstw, int dsth, int srcw, int srch);imagecreate作用:建立新图 用法:int imagecreate(int x_size, int y_size); imagedashedline作用:绘虚线 用法:int imagedashedline(int im, int x1, int y1, int x2, int y2, int col); imagedestroy 作用:结束图形 用法解释:int imagedestroy(int im);imagefill作用:图形着色 用法:int imagefill(int im, int x, int y, int col);imagefilledpolygon作用:多边形区域着色 用法:int imagefilledpolygon(int im, array points, int num_points,int col);imagefilledrectangle作用:矩形区域着色 用法:int imagefilledrectangle(int im, int x1, int y1, int x2, inty2, int col);imagefilltoborder作用:指定颜色区域内着色 用法:int imagefilltoborder(int im, int x, int y, int border,int col);imagefontheight作用:取得字型的高度 用法:int imagefontheight(int font);imagefontwidth作用:取得字型的宽度 用法:int imagefontwidth(int font);imageinterlace作用:使用交错式显示与否 用法:int imageinterlace(int im, int [interlace]);imageline作用:绘实线 用法:int imageline(int im, int x1, int y1, int x2, int y2, int col);imageloadfont作用:载入点阵字型 用法:int imageloadfont(string file); imagepolygon作用:绘多边形 用法:int imagepolygon(int im, array points, int num_points, int col); imagerectangle作用:绘矩形 用法:int imagerectangle(int im, int x1, int y1, int x2, int y2, int col);imagesetpixel作用:绘点 用法:int imagesetpixel(int im, int x, int y, int col); imagestring 作用:绘横式字符串 用法:int imagestring(int im, int font, int x, int y, string s, int col);imagestringup作用:绘直式字符串 用法:int imagestringup(int im, int font, int x, int y, string s, intcol); imagesx作用:取得图片的宽度 用法:int imagesx(int im);imagesy作用:取得图片的高度 用法:int imagesy(int im); imagettfbbox作用:计算 ttf 文字所占区域 用法:array imagettfbbox(int size, int angle, string fontfile, string text);imagettftext作用:写 ttf 文字到图中 用法:array imagettftext(int im, int size, int angle, int x, int y,int col, string fontfile, string text); imagecolorat 作用:取得图中指定点颜色的索引值 用法:intimagecolorat(int im, int x, int y); imagecolorclosest作用:计算色表中与指定颜色最接近者 用法:int imagecolorclosest(int im, int red, int green, int blue); imagecolorexact作用:计算色表上指定颜色索引值 用法:int imagecolorexact(int im, int red, int green, int blue); imagecolorresolve作用:计算色表上指定或最接近颜色的索引值 用法:int imagecolorresolve(int im, int red, int green, intblue);imagecolorset作用:设定色表上指定索引的颜色 用法:boolean imagecolorset(int im, int index, int red, int green, intblue); imagecolorsforindex 作用:取得色表上指定索引的颜色 用法:array imagecolorsforindex(int im, intindex); imagecolorstotal作用:计算图的颜色数 用法:int imagecolorstotal(int im); imagepsloadfont 作用:载入 postscript 字型 用法:int imagepsloadfont(string filename);imagepsfreefont作用:卸下 postscript 字型 用法:void imagepsfreefont(int fontindex);imagepsencodefont作用:postscript 字型转成向量字 用法:int imagepsencodefont(string encodingfile); imagepstext作用:写 postscript 文字到图中 用法:array imagepstext(int image, string text, int font, intsize, int foreground, int background, int x, int y, int space, int tightness, float angle, intantialias_steps); imagepsbbox作用:计算 postscript 文字所占区域 用法: array imagepsbbox(string text, int font, int size,int space, int width, float angle);imagecreatefrompng作用:取出 png 图型 用法:int imagecreatefrompng(string filename); imagepng作用:建立 png 图型 用法:int imagepng(int im, string [filename]);imagecreatefromgif作用:取出 gif 图型 用法:int imagecreatefromgif(string filename); imagegif作用:建立 gif 图型 用法:int imagegif(int im, string [filename]);

如何查看php是否支持GD库

文章TAG:如何查看空间是否如何查看空间是否开启了gd库

最近更新

  • 南阳关键词如何联系,为什么网站的关键词百度上突然找不到了南阳关键词如何联系,为什么网站的关键词百度上突然找不到了

    为什么网站的关键词百度上突然找不到了我的一个关键词今天也消失了.可能是短暂的更新问题,再等等我的一个关键词今天也消失了.可能是短暂的更新问题,再等等2,百度新闻怎么发布具体操作.....

    jsp技术 日期:2023-06-06

  • 网址注册多少钱,注册一个网站要多少钱网址注册多少钱,注册一个网站要多少钱

    注册一个网站要多少钱2,建立一个网站需要多少钱3,一般注册一个域名大概多要多少钱4,注册一个完整的网站需要多少钱5,注册网站需要多少钱1,注册一个网站要多少钱域名加空间,起码200多2,建立一.....

    jsp技术 日期:2023-06-06

  • 华为设置闹钟,华为手机提醒闹钟如何设置华为设置闹钟,华为手机提醒闹钟如何设置

    华为手机提醒闹钟如何设置2,我是华为手机如何设置闹钟3,华为nova4如何设置闹钟1,华为手机提醒闹钟如何设置以华为mate20为例:1、首先我们在华为手机上左右的滑动屏幕,在屏幕上找到“时钟”.....

    jsp技术 日期:2023-06-06

  • 如何配置php网站,网站如何调用PHP如何配置php网站,网站如何调用PHP

    网站如何调用PHP在服务器上没有问题,说明你服务器上的这个网站空间配置了PHP环境IIS不行,困为IIS默认是不支持PHP的,如果想让IIS支持PHP是需要配置的使用ws,或者把php做成服务,asp按密钥请.....

    jsp技术 日期:2023-06-06

  • icp备案如何做,ICP备案编号如何申请icp备案如何做,ICP备案编号如何申请

    ICP备案编号如何申请有两种方式:一种登陆www.miibeian.gov.cn备案网站自行办理备案手续;另一种可委托其它接入服务单位帮助其备案。备过案的网站仍要备案,获得新的备案号后,以前的号码不.....

    jsp技术 日期:2023-06-06

  • iis管理器如何建站,IIS怎么搭建网站iis管理器如何建站,IIS怎么搭建网站

    IIS怎么搭建网站首先打开IIS管理器,属性---新建网站---填写描述---主机头,IP和文件目录--设置权限,(图文教程:http://www.idcpj.cn/article/20141110185321.html);然后解析好域名就可以打开网.....

    jsp技术 日期:2023-06-06

  • 公司按行业分为哪些类型,公司种类有哪些公司按行业分为哪些类型,公司种类有哪些

    公司种类有哪些2,公司的分类有哪些3,上市公司一般以行业分类有哪些啊1,公司种类有哪些法律上定义的公司种类有哪些呢1、个人独资公司,顾名思义,就是有个人注册,个人所有,承担的责任有个人承担.....

    jsp技术 日期:2023-06-06

  • 外贸建站要多少钱,外贸网站建设要多少钱外贸建站要多少钱,外贸网站建设要多少钱

    外贸网站建设要多少钱几百块钱起步,要看你要求怎样,还有不计其数的个人的几百,正规的几千2,建设一个外贸网站商城网站需要多少钱6000-12000左右,看复杂程度~使用开源的ecshop程序,我拿它来.....

    jsp技术 日期:2023-06-06